4. Trello with Butler AI: Automate Your Workflow

Best for: Project management and task automation

Trello is already a popular project management tool, but the integration of Butler AI has made it even more efficient. Butler AI automates repetitive tasks within your Trello boards, allowing you to focus on more important work. From automatically moving tasks between lists to sending reminder notifications, Butler AI ensures that your projects move along without manual intervention.

Why it’s trending: As more teams shift to agile workflows, automation has become a key feature for reducing the time spent on project management tasks. Trello’s Butler AI makes task automation accessible to everyone, no coding required.

Key Features:

  • Custom rule creation for automating tasks
  • Automatic updates and notifications for task changes
  • Workflow automation with zero coding

5. Otter.ai: Transcribe and Summarize Meetings Instantly

Best for: Meeting transcription and note-taking

Tired of taking notes during long meetings? Otter.ai uses AI to transcribe conversations in real-time, providing accurate and searchable transcripts. It’s a lifesaver for anyone who needs to focus on the conversation instead of scrambling to jot down notes. Whether you’re in a Zoom call or recording a brainstorming session, Otter.ai ensures you never miss a word.

Why it’s trending: With the rise of virtual meetings and remote collaboration, efficient note-taking has become essential. Otter.ai not only transcribes but also highlights key points and allows users to tag participants.

Key Features:

  • Real-time transcription during meetings
  • Integration with Zoom and Google Meet
  • Keyword highlights and smart search
